I’ve never made stuffed peppers but my FIL says they’re his favorite so I’m attempting them tonight. I’m using the Joy of Cooking recipe - it’s pretty basic. I don’t anticipate any trouble with this but it’s looks pretty bland. Any suggestions on tarting them up?
You really want to mess with a favorite ???

Are these the kind with ground beef, rice, tomato sauce and seasonings inside? A few simple ideas: Mix ground beef and ground pork if you have it, or even a little pork sausage. Add paprika and garlic to give it more of a Hungarian stuffed pepper taste. Mix just a little of the sauce in with the filling and put the rest over the top of the peppers - I assume you could even bake them in the sauce. If you all are ok with spicy, add some diced chile peppers to the sauce on top.
